Kamy Scarlett is the chief human resources officer for Best Buy Co. Inc. In this role, she oversees talent development and the health and well-being of our employees worldwide, with a focus on making Best Buy one of the best places to work in America.
Additionally, Kamy serves as executive vice of Best Buy Canada, where the company operates more than 150 stores. She also previously served as the company’s president of U.S. retail stores for about a year, leading the execution and operation of all domestic Best Buy locations.
Kamy joined Best Buy in 2014. Prior to her current role, she was senior vice president of retail and chief human resources officer for Best Buy Canada. She was responsible for the sales and profits of the company’s stores in addition to enacting the human resources and talent management strategies for the Canadian operations.
Since beginning her career in retail more than 30 years ago, Kamy has served in a variety of retail, operations, marketing and human resources leadership roles. She has a proven record of driving great customer experiences and financial results, as well as the creation and execution of HR and operations strategies and organizational transformation. This has led to great success in building strong cultures of high employee engagement, cost reduction, succession planning, training and development, and productivity improvements.
Prior to joining Best Buy, Kamy was the chief operating officer at Grafton-Fraser Inc., a leading Canadian retailer of men’s apparel. She also previously held leadership roles at Loblaw Cos., Hudson’s Bay Co. and Dylex Inc.
Kamy serves on the boards of the Best Buy Foundation and Floor & Décor, a leading specialty retailer of hard surface flooring based in Atlanta.

Has Kathleen Scarlett been buying or selling shares of Best Buy?
Kathleen Scarlett has not been actively trading shares of Best Buy over the course of the past ninety days. Most recently, Kathleen Scarlett sold 25,071 shares of the business's stock in a transaction on Monday, September 19th. The shares were sold at an average price of $72.37, for a transaction totalling $1,814,388.27.
